That is also correct. It does not work like in PnP. It only increases your caster level which impacts things like duration or length of the spell, dispel-ability, overcoming spell resistance, that sort of thing. But the MH levels will not give you more spells or more spells per day.The MH levels will add to CL but not to actual spells known and wont increase what level spells I can cast as a Bard, correct?
But the nice thing is your bard and MH levels will stack together for your bard song as long as you have enough perform ranks.
